Output 3ddddf14c82b71e596a4d3f3c483346a1a8ea6a88f219b3de41649a8cf68a201:1
- value
- 19647702
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4e57b003d985af92a1b441dc6846a53f188477de OP_EQUALVERIFY OP_CHECKSIG
- address
- 189EkbsKYw1Cw14WgbosKvTunGAXz5G8Rx
- transaction
- 3ddddf14c82b71e596a4d3f3c483346a1a8ea6a88f219b3de41649a8cf68a201
- confirmations
- 430607
- spent
- true